[0018]According to the present invention, a method for continuously playing video clips without regeneration comprises the following steps:

[0019]Step 1: establishing OUT-point setting rules, according to, for example, actual situations of a certain game, and setting different durations or a single duration for the OUT-point setting rules;

[0020]Step 2: capturing at least one stream of a game video;

[0021]Step 3: monitoring the captured game video, and setting an IN point when a critical motion occurs;

[0022]Step 4: automatically choosing and applying one said OUT-point setting rule, and obtaining corresponding duration information related to the chosen rule;

[0023]Step 5: according to the duration information and a position of the IN point, calculating a position of the OUT point, so as to form a clip record, which at least includes a name of the game video, and information about time-based positions of the IN point and the OUT point in the game video;

Abstract

A method for continuously playing video clips without regeneration involves calling on clip records to be continuously played, making an index file according to the order of playback, during replay, finding out a game video of a current play node and its start position and end position, playing the game video to S second before an OUT point, starting to pre-read a video of the next play node and storing it in a memory, and when the current play node is played to its end, reading out the pre-read video from the memory and playing it, thereby achieving seamless playback.

TECHNICAL FIELD OF THE INVENTION[0001]The present invention relates to a method for continuously playing video clips without regeneration.DESCRIPTION OF THE PRIOR ART[0002]Presently, for live broadcast of a sports game, multiple video cameras are deployed to capture live videos from different viewpoints, and these video sources have to be in-site processed for making clips for immediate replay. In the process, a producer monitoring the captured video sources sets an IN point at the beginning of a critical motion, and sets an OUT point at the end of the very critical motions, so as to define and store a video clip. Then the producer writes the recording site and name of the clip to form a retrievable index keyword, which allows retrieval of the video clip when a corresponding replay is required during the live broadcast.
